Output efd3214a5885b82fcbb2b4998cb4f05b8e1d0896010bb8dbd3c8e71dc960c176:0

value
133106
script pubkey
OP_0 OP_PUSHBYTES_20 4031f9e3cafcd597ac5df24a3f27e4b881656e25
address
bc1qgqclnc72ln2e0tza7f9r7flyhzqk2m39ayvt2y
transaction
efd3214a5885b82fcbb2b4998cb4f05b8e1d0896010bb8dbd3c8e71dc960c176
confirmations
126
spent
true